I noticed that issue when I was running the truck initially with the softer rear springs back when I first got it, and I noticed it when I had the heavier Blue fronts. When I changed to white fronts on the rear, she jumped nose level to nose slightly nose down which for the large jump I was clearing worked great.
How I approached the jump mattered too, if I was just coasting at speed and hit it, it would go tail high.
Got in my M2C toe in blocks as well as some new tires to try. Will report on how it goes, may head out to a close by unfinished track and see.
Truck loves money going into it, but, its a blast to drive LOL.

Yeah, I have driven my friends scte and it was definitely more stable in the fast sections and in the air, but I could not get it to turn in nearly as sharp as the AE.
I felt very lazy entering a turn. Tried more front toe out, helped a little but no matter what I tweaked I could not get it to tun in like the AE.
